Freedom of Information request Monitoring Technology used in Patient Bedrooms

Response published: 30 October 2025

FOI Request

Dear Gloucestershire Health and Care NHS Foundation Trust, I am writing to request the following information under the Freedom of Information Act. 1. Please confirm, does the Trust use, or have plans to use, Oxevision* in ward bedrooms, 136 suites and/or seclusion rooms? *Please note that Oxevision may be referred to by other names including LIO or 'vision-based monitoring technology' etc. It is an infrared camera system. 2. Please confirm, does that Trust use, or have plans to use, ‘Project X’^ in ward bedrooms, 136 suites and/or seclusion rooms. ^Please note that Project X may be referred to by different names, for the avoidance of doubt it is marketed by Safehinge Primera and may be described as a ‘non-visual patient safety aid’ and uses radar to track patients’ movements. 3. Please outline whether the trust uses any other video, camera or vision-based patient monitoring systems within patient bedrooms. Please state brand names if appropriate. 4. If the response to any of the above questions is ‘yes’, please provide the following information: 4.1. Please confirm the number of wards/136 suites/seclusion rooms, and provide ward names, where Oxevision/Project X/other vision based monitoring technologies is currently used. 4.2. Please provide your policy or standard operating procedure for the use of Oxevision/Project X/other vision based monitoring technologies, up to the date and time of this request. 4.3. Please provide your Data Protection Impact assessment for the use of Oxevision/Project X/other vision based monitoring technologies. 4.4. Please provide an Equality Impact Assessment in relation to the use of Oxevision/Project X/other vision based monitoring technologies 4.5. Please state the contract end date(s) for all current contract(s) with Oxehealth/LIO health/other organisations that provide the above technologies.. 4.6. Please provide patient posters, leaflets and/or information packs.

FOI Response

Freedom of Information Request – Ref: FOI 278-2025

Thank you for your recent Freedom of Information request. Please find our response below.

You asked:

1. Please confirm, does the Trust use, or have plans to use, Oxevision* in ward bedrooms, 136 suites and/or seclusion rooms?

Our response:

No

You asked:

2. Please confirm, does that Trust use, or have plans to use, ‘Project X’^ in ward bedrooms, 136 suites and/or seclusion rooms.

Our response:

No

You asked:

3. Please outline whether the trust uses any other video, camera or vision-based patient monitoring systems within patient bedrooms. Please state brand names if appropriate.

Our response:

None used.
